6. e cannot find the headset e The headset may be connected to a previously paired device Turn off the connected device or move it out of range e Pairing may have been reset or the headset has been previously paired with another device Pair the headset with the mobile phone again as described in the user manual see Pair the headset with your mobile phone on page 4 Voice dialing or redialing does not work on my mobile phone Your mobile phone may not support this feature My Bluetooth headset is connected to a Bluetooth stereo enabled mobile phone but music only plays on the mobile phone speaker Refer to the user manual of your mobile phone Select to listen to music through the headset The audio quality is poor and crackling noise can be heard The Bluetooth device is out of range Reduce the distance between your headset and Bluetooth device or remove obstacles between them The audio quality is poor when streaming from the mobile phone is very slow or audio streaming does not work at all Make sure your mobile phone not only supports mono HSP HFP but also supports A2DP see Technical data on page 7 hear but cannot control music on my Bluetooth device e g play pause skip forward backward Make sure the Bluetooth audio source supports AVRCP see Technical data on page 7 For further support visit www philips com support 2014 OWOOX Innovations Limited All rights reserved Philips an

9. r product at www philips com welcome With this Philips wireless on ear headset you can e enjoy convenient wireless handsfree calls e enjoy and control wireless music e switch between calls and music What s in the box Philips Bluetooth wireless on ear headset SHB5500 Quick start guide Other devices A mobile phone or device e g notebook PDA Bluetooth adapters MP3 players etc which supports Bluetooth and is compatible to the headset Overview of your wireless on ear headset D LED light O Call Music button GB Microphone O Micro USB charging slot O Volume Track control button EN 3 3 Get started Charge your headset E Before you use your headset for the first time charge the battery for 5 hours for optimum battery capacity and lifetime Use only the original USB charging cable to avoid any damage Finish your call before charging the headset as connecting the headset for charging will power the headset off You can operate the headset normally during charging Connect the supplied USB charging cable to e the micro USB charging slot on the headset and e the charger USB port of a computer L gt LED turns white during charging and turns off when the headset is fully charged Tip Normally a full charge takes 3 hours Pair the headset with your mobile phone Before you use the headset with your mobile phone for the firs

11. t time pair it with a mobile phone A successful pairing establishes a unique encrypted link between the headset and mobile phone The headset stores the last 8 devices in the memory If you try to pair more than 8 devices the earliest paired device is replaced by the new one 1 Make sure that the mobile phone is turned on and its Bluetooth feature is activated 4 EN 2 Make sure that the headset is fully charged and turned off 3 Press and hold Er until the blue and white LED flashes alternately L gt The headset remains in pairing mode for 5 minutes 4 Pair the headset with the mobile phone For detailed information refer to the user manual of your mobile phone The following example shows you how to pair the headset with your mobile phone 1 Activate the Bluetooth feature of your mobile phone select Philips SHB5500 2 Enter the headset password 0000 4 zeros if prompted For those mobile phones featuring Bluetooth 2 1 EDR or higher no need to enter a password Add Philips SHB5500 Enter Password Bluetooth device 0000 4 Use your headset Connect the headset to a Bluetooth device 1 Tumon your mobile phone Bluetooth device 2 Press and hold Coa to turn the headset on L gt The blue LED flashes L gt The headset is reconnected to the last connected mobile phone Bluetooth device automatically If the last one is not available the headset tries to reconnect to the second last connect
